+# cpr test
+
+# Copyright (c) 2021, 2022 Oracle and/or its affiliates.
+#
+# This work is licensed under the terms of the GNU GPL, version 2.
+# See the COPYING file in the top-level directory.
+
+import tempfile
+from avocado_qemu import QemuSystemTest
+from avocado.utils import wait
+
+class Cpr(QemuSystemTest):
+ """
+ :avocado: tags=cpr
+ """
+
+ timeout = 5
+ fast_timeout = 1
+
+ @staticmethod
+ def has_status(vm, status):
+ return vm.command('query-status')['status'] == status
+
+ def wait_for_status(self, vm, status):
+ wait.wait_for(self.has_status,
+ timeout=self.timeout,
+ step=0.1,
+ args=(vm,status,))
+
+ def run_and_fail(self, vm, msg):
+ # Qemu will fail fast, so disable monitor to avoid timeout in accept
+ vm.set_qmp_monitor(False)
+ vm.launch()
+ vm.wait(self.timeout)
+ self.assertRegex(vm.get_log(), msg)
+
+ def do_cpr_restart(self, vmstate_name):
+ vm = self.get_vm('-nodefaults',
+ '-cpr-enable', 'restart',
+ '-object', 'memory-backend-memfd,id=pc.ram,size=8M',
+ '-machine', 'memory-backend=pc.ram')
+
+ vm.launch()
+
+ vm.qmp('cpr-save', filename=vmstate_name, mode='restart')
+ vm.event_wait(name='STOP', timeout=self.fast_timeout)
+
+ args = vm.full_args + ['-S']
+ vm.qmp('cpr-exec', argv=args)
+
+ # exec closes the monitor socket, so reopen it.
+ vm.reopen_qmp_connection()
+
+ self.wait_for_status(vm, 'prelaunch')
+ vm.qmp('cpr-load', filename=vmstate_name, mode='restart')
+ vm.event_wait(name='RESUME', timeout=self.fast_timeout)
+
+ self.assertEqual(vm.command('query-status')['status'], 'running')
+
+ def do_cpr_reboot(self, vmstate_name):
+ old_vm = self.get_vm('-nodefaults',
+ '-cpr-enable', 'reboot')
+ old_vm.launch()
+
+ old_vm.qmp('cpr-save', filename=vmstate_name, mode='reboot')
+ old_vm.event_wait(name='STOP', timeout=self.fast_timeout)
+
+ new_vm = self.get_vm('-nodefaults',
+ '-cpr-enable', 'reboot',
+ '-S')
+ new_vm.launch()
+ self.wait_for_status(new_vm, 'prelaunch')
+
+ new_vm.qmp('cpr-load', filename=vmstate_name, mode='reboot')
+ new_vm.event_wait(name='RESUME', timeout=self.fast_timeout)
+
+ self.assertEqual(new_vm.command('query-status')['status'], 'running')
+
+ def test_cpr_restart(self):
+ """
+ Verify that cpr restart mode works
+ """
+ with tempfile.NamedTemporaryFile() as vmstate_file:
+ self.do_cpr_restart(vmstate_file.name)
+
+ def test_cpr_reboot(self):
+ """
+ Verify that cpr reboot mode works
+ """
+ with tempfile.NamedTemporaryFile() as vmstate_file:
+ self.do_cpr_reboot(vmstate_file.name)
+
+ def test_cpr_block_cpr_save(self):
+
+ """
+ Verify that qemu rejects cpr-save for volatile memory
+ """
+ vm = self.get_vm('-nodefaults',
+ '-cpr-enable', 'restart')
+ vm.launch()
+ rsp = vm.qmp('cpr-save', filename='/dev/null', mode='restart')
+ vm.qmp('quit')
+
+ expect = r'Memory region .* is volatile'
+ self.assertRegex(rsp['error']['desc'], expect)
+
+ def test_cpr_block_memfd(self):
+
+ """
+ Verify that qemu complains for only-cpr-capable and volatile memory
+ """
+ vm = self.get_vm('-nodefaults',
+ '-cpr-enable', 'restart',
+ '-only-cpr-capable')
+ self.run_and_fail(vm, r'only-cpr-capable specified.* Memory ')
+
+ def test_cpr_block_replay(self):
+ """
+ Verify that qemu complains for only-cpr-capable and replay
+ """
+ vm = self.get_vm('-nodefaults',
+ '-cpr-enable', 'restart',
+ '-object', 'memory-backend-memfd,id=pc.ram,size=8M',
+ '-machine', 'memory-backend=pc.ram',
+ '-only-cpr-capable',
+ '-icount', 'shift=10,rr=record,rrfile=/dev/null')
+ self.run_and_fail(vm, r'only-cpr-capable specified.* replay ')
+
+ def test_cpr_block_chardev(self):
+ """
+ Verify that qemu complains for only-cpr-capable and unsupported chardev
+ """
+ vm = self.get_vm('-nodefaults',
+ '-cpr-enable', 'restart',
+ '-object', 'memory-backend-memfd,id=pc.ram,size=8M',
+ '-machine', 'memory-backend=pc.ram',
+ '-only-cpr-capable',
+ '-chardev', 'vc,id=vc1')
+ self.run_and_fail(vm, r'only-cpr-capable specified.* vc1 ')
+
+ def test_cpr_allow_chardev(self):
+ """
+ Verify that qemu allows unsupported chardev with reopen-on-cpr
+ """
+ vm = self.get_vm('-nodefaults',
+ '-cpr-enable', 'restart',
+ '-object', 'memory-backend-memfd,id=pc.ram,size=8M',
+ '-machine', 'memory-backend=pc.ram',
+ '-only-cpr-capable',
+ '-chardev', 'vc,id=vc1,reopen-on-cpr=on')
+ vm.launch()
+ self.wait_for_status(vm, 'running')
